Assembly Adventures: The instructions were clear, but mounting required two people and some stud-finding gymnastics (pro tip: pre-drill alternate holes if your studs don't align). The hollow-door knob installation was tricky—I dropped screws inside like a clumsy magician. Save yourself the hassle: attach knobs BEFORE hanging doors!
